Responsibilities Conduct comprehensive Fire Risk Assessments across a range of commercial, residential, and public-sector properties. Produce clear, concise, and fully compliant FRA reports. Provide expert guidance to clients on fire safety legislation and best practice (including the Fire Safety Order 2005). Identify hazards, evaluate risks, and recommend proportionate actions. Liaise with building managers, contractors, and internal teams to ensure corrective measures are completed. Keep up to date with industry standards, regulations, and training. Requirements Proven experience as a Fire Risk Assessor (minimum 1–2 years preferred). Recognised fire safety qualification such as NEBOSH Fire, IFE, FRAR, FSO, or equivalent. Strong understanding of current fire safety legislation and British Standards. Excellent written communication and report‑writing skills. Full UK driving licence.
